Audio vk сайт: Скачать музыку с ВК — официальный сайт программы VKSaver

VKPLS — Генерация потокового аудио-плейлиста из vk.com / Хабр

Хочу поделиться с читателями «Хабрахабра» небольшим веб-сервисом (скриптом), который написал для себя.

С появлением социальных сетей и их широким распространением пользователи довольно много времени проводят в онлайне. Все любят музыку, а лично я без нее жить не могу. Так вышло, что всю свою музыкальную коллекцию храню в профайле «Вконтакте». Поскольку всегда в курсе новинок, не трачу свое время на поиск и скачивание, а возможность доступа к своей музыке почти с любого гаджета в любом месте где есть интернет придает максимум удобства. Я очень рад, что прошли те деревянные времена, когда хороший интернет был роскошью. Больше нет необходимости хранить такую информацию на своем жестком диске. Все, что не конфиденциально, выбрасываю в облако.

Большую часть своей работы я выполняю за компьютером, а это значит, что музыка мне необходима как кислород — чтобы сконцентрироваться на поставленных задачах. Врубаешь любимый альбом в 5. 1 и творишь. Но есть одно но: чтобы послушать музыку в VK.com, я должен зайти в онлайн, а если заходишь в онлайн — то непременно получаешь кучу сообщений и затягиваешься в нежелательные беседы. Я человек добрый и отзывчивый, поэтому не могу игнорировать своих друзей с их постоянными проблемами. Но ведь мне нужно сконцентрироваться на работе, а вся моя музыка там, где меня всегда что-то отвлекает.


Я обожаю Linux, но нормальных плагинов для музыкальных плееров или самих плееров для прослушивания музыки с VK.com так и не встретил. Тогда решил, что с этим нужно что-то делать и накидал за пару часов небольшой php скрипт, который и назвал vkpls (не трудно догадаться, что я имел ввиду).

Суть скрипта в получении прямых ссылок на аудиозаписи и генерации потокового плейлиста, алгоритм до безобразия прост, я завязал его на VK.API:

Для начала я создал Standalone приложение в разделе «Для разработчиков» и получил для него права на доступ к аудиозаписям. После этого мне необходимо было пройти авторизацию для создания ACCESS_TOKEN, т.

к. доступ к информации об аудиозаписях (метод audio.get в vk.api) невозможен по простому POST или GET запросу.

Теперь я мог с помощью средств старенького PHP направлять запрос с интересующими меня параметрами без ограничений, а в ответ получать интересующую меня информацию в формате JSON. Функция audio.get возвращает список аудиозаписей пользователя или сообщества со всей дополнительной информацией. Бинго, это-то мне и было нужно.

Так, например, в ответ такого запроса:

https://api.vk.com/method/audio.get?user_id=ВАШ_ID&v=5.28&access_token=ВАШ_ACCESS_TOKEN

мы получаем массив в формате JSON со следующей информацией:

Ответ на audio.get в JSON

response: {
count: 505,
items: [{
id: ’34’,
photo: ‘http://cs7009.vk….2/rj4RvYLCobY.jpg’,
name: ‘Tatyana Plutalova’,
name_gen: ‘Tatyana’
}, {
id: 232745053,
owner_id: 34,
artist: ‘Ambassadeurs’,
title: ‘Sparks’,
duration: 274,
url: ‘http://cs6164. vk….lGEJhqRK8d5OQZngI’,
lyrics_id: 120266970,
genre_id: 18
}, {
id: 232733966,
owner_id: 34,
artist: ‘Aloe Blacc’,
title: ‘Can You Do This ‘,
duration: 176,
url: ‘http://cs6157.vk….erOa0DvsyOCYTPO1w’,
genre_id: 2
}, {
id: 232735496,
owner_id: 34,
artist: ‘Aloe Blacc’,
title: ‘Wake Me Up’,
duration: 224,
url: ‘http://cs6109.vk….FzHJU55ixz8Av8ujc’,
lyrics_id: 119056069,
genre_id: 2
}]
}

Посмотрите — интересующие нас ключи artist, title, duration, url присутствуют для каждой аудиозаписи. Воспользовавшись функцией json_decode я преобразовал полученный массив в понятный для php формат. Все, что мне осталось для достижения результата — это сгенерировать файл плейлиста.

Структура M3U плэйлиста:

#EXTM3U
#EXTINF:duration,artist — title
url

Не было ничего проще записать в файл с помощью цикла foreach все полученные данные и сохранить его в m3u.
Ура, все получилось, теперь я могу слушать музыку в любом музыкальном плеере без необходимости авторизации вконтакте.

Резюме

Я решил поделиться своей идеей и сделать ее доступной для таких же, как я. С помощью CSS фрэймворка Maxmertkit (представленного одним из пользователей «Хабрахабра» здесь) сверстал небольшую страницу для удобства использования скрипта. Для всех желающих она доступна по следующей ссылке — VKPLS. Там же вы можете прочитать инструкцию или посмотреть видео.

Следует отметить, что существует одно но. В связи с тем, что ссылки на аудиозаписи на серверах «Вконтакте» меняются с переодичностью в 0,5 — 3 дня, рекомендую чаще обновлять свой плэйлист.

На этом все, спасибо за внимание.

Парсинг аудио человека ВКонтакте | Сервис поиска аудитории ВКонтакте vk.barkov.net

Наш сервис VK.BARKOV.NET технически предоставляет вам массу вариантов для поиска и сбора нужной вам аудитории ВКонтакте и парсинга открытых данных об этой аудитории.

Если вас интересует парсинг аудио человека ВКонтакте, то начните по ссылке ниже, чтобы собрать самые свежие данные по аудиозаписям пользователей ВК.
По исполнителям или жанрам любимой музыки парсер (специальный инструмент) соберет пользователей ВК, у которых эти записи в предпочтениях.
Более точное указание данных людей — возраст, дни рождения, город или страна — помогут вам собрать в отчет пользователей ВКонтакте, отвечающих этим поисковым запросам.

Возможно делать поиск по любимой музыке человека. Для этого перейдите по ссылке https://vk.barkov.net/filter.aspx в пустое поле скопируйте список ID нужных вам пользователей, а в пункте настроек 10 впишите ключевые слова «любимая музыка», а специальная функция (скрипт) сможет спарсить для вас эту информацию по тем пользователям, у которых она указана.

Таким образом вы сможете получить сведения о любимой музыке интересующих вас пользователей ВКонтакте.


Запустить скрипт для решения вопроса

Полезный небольшой видеоурок по этой теме

О сервисе поиска аудитории ВКонтакте

vk. barkov.net — это универсальный набор инструментов, который собирает самые разнообразные данные из ВКонтакте в удобном виде.

Каждый инструмент (скрипт) решает свою задачу:

Например, есть скрипт для получения списка всех подписчиков группы.
А вот тут лежит скрипт для сбора списка всех людей, поставивших лайк или сделавших репост к конкретному посту на стене или к любым постам на стене.
Ещё есть скрипт для получения списка аккаунтов в других соцсетях подписчиков группы ВКонтакте.

И таких скриптов уже более 200. Все они перечислены в меню слева. И мы регулярно добавляем новые скрипты по запросам пользователей.


Запустить скрипт для решения вопроса

Полезные ответы на вопросы по этому же функционалу для сбора данных из ВКонтакте

Как собрать ВК всех слушателей исполнителя какого-то в определенном городе

Парсинг музыкальных предпочтений пользователей ВКонтакте

Поиск людей ВКонтакте по музыкальным трекам

Как собрать ВКонтакте людей, музыкальные группы или паблики, где опубликован пост об определенной музыкальной группе?

Сбор аудитории VK, слушающей группу Deep Purple

Найти людей в ВК, у которых в аудиозаписях есть исполнители

Собрать мужчин 25 — 50 лет в ВК по слушаемой музыке

Собрать целевую аудиторию из ВК, найти людей, которые слушают рок, джаз, блюз, классику и после того отправить им приглашения на концерт

Парсинг людей ВКонтакте по определенным аудиотрекам

Искать людей по их любимым музыкальным исполнителям ВКонтакте

Найти людей из Москвы по определенной аудиозаписи в ВК

Программа поиска людей по их музыке ВКонтакте

Люди от 30 лет по музыкальным предпочтениям ВКонтакте

По людям найти, в каких группах они админы ВКонтакте

Парсить в ВК людей из определенных городов, которые слушают Алису

Поиск аудиозаписей у пользователей ВК

Собрать целевую аудитории в вк для организаторов музыкальных мероприятий

Собрать в ВК тех, кто слушает конкретную музыку

У кого в ВК есть этническая музыка

Спарсить аудиозаписи определенных жанров ВКонтакте

Balanced Audio Technology VK-43SE Preamplifier – 10 Audio

Balanced Audio Technology (BAT) – компания с многолетней историей, специализирующаяся, как вы уже догадались, на балансных аудиокомпонентах. Они произвели длинную линейку ламповых и полупроводниковых предусилителей и усилителей, фонокорректоров и, совсем недавно, цифровых преобразователей. Интегральный усилитель BAT VK-300xSE был рассмотрен здесь в 2004 году, а ламповый предусилитель VK-31SE был рассмотрен здесь в 2005 году. На протяжении многих лет компания BAT получала многочисленные награды «лучшие из» за превосходное звучание и инновационные продукты.

Произошло сближение качества звука ламповых и полупроводниковых компонентов, которое происходило постепенно с тех пор, как в 1960-х годах твердотельные устройства взорвались на рынке. За последние несколько лет это сближение, похоже, вступило в завершающую фазу, потому что некоторые полупроводниковые компоненты соответствуют или превышают столь желаемую звуковую силу лампового оборудования. Это актуально для данного обзора не только для демонстрации технологии, которая давно разрабатывается, но и для того, чтобы дать потребителям аудио возможность не полагаться на какую-либо конкретную технологию при рассмотрении вопроса об изменении системы.

Трубчатым роликам тут делать нечего.

Стерео аналоговый линейный полупроводниковый предусилитель BAT VK-43SE стоимостью 8995 долларов США был запрошен для этого обзора, чтобы помочь убедиться в зрелости полупроводниковой технологии и услышать новейший первоклассный полупроводниковый предусилитель от ЛЕТУЧАЯ МЫШЬ. Стив Беднарски, генеральный менеджер BAT, был очень любезен и любезен, принимая участие в этом обзоре. Из описания BAT этой модели:

«Сочетая фирменную высокоточную одноступенчатую топологию BAT с выходами с трансформаторной связью, которыми оснащены все предусилители Balanced Audio Technology Special Edition, VK-43SE устанавливает новый эталон производительности. Модернизированные выходные трансформаторы работают в сочетании с симметричным N-канальным одноступенчатым блоком усиления с высоким смещением. Полностью сбалансированная конструкция двойного моно и емкость источника питания более 55 000 мкФ обеспечивают мгновенный отклик на самые высокие требования к сигналу.

Маслонаполненные конденсаторы второго поколения обеспечивают повышенную чистоту элегантной схемы Unistage, дополняя новый флагманский полупроводниковый предусилитель BAT».

В состав VK-43SE входит запатентованный электронный шунтирующий аттенюатор, который имеет 140 шагов с разрешением 0,5 дБ. В основном прослушивание проводилось с регулятором громкости в диапазоне от 30 до 60, а очень точная регулировка на 0,5 дБ доставляла удовольствие, позволяя получить нужную громкость, хотя изменение от 30 до 60 занимает несколько секунд. Большой диапазон регулировки громкости практически гарантирует совместимость VK-43SE с любым усилителем мощности на планете. Также доступен дополнительный внутренний фонокорректор VK-P20. 10 Аудио запросил только линейный каскад, поэтому надстройка модуля фонокорректора здесь не тестировалась. Имеется 3 симметричных аналоговых входа XLR и 2 несимметричных входа RCA. Два выхода на разъемах XLR, а выход для магнитофона — на разъемах RCA. Нет триггерного входа или выхода.

Всеми функциями можно управлять с помощью превосходного металлического пульта дистанционного управления, включая настройку баланса, отключения звука и фазы. Дисплей передней панели с регулируемой яркостью имеет крупные надписи и может быть установлен с пользовательскими названиями входов, такими как «LP» вместо входа 1. Стандартная гарантия составляет 5 лет. Пользовательский интерфейс для настройки и обычной работы превосходен.

Другие компоненты, которые были под рукой во время прослушивания, включают проигрыватель VPI Aries 3 с 4-точечным тонармом Kuzma, ZYX UNIverse Premium и картриджи с подвижной катушкой Miyajima Madake; Б.М.С. фонокорректоры MCCI ULN и Pass Labs XP-25; собственный музыкальный компьютер с Windows 10, работающий под управлением JRiver Media Center; ЦАП Wyred 4 Sound DAC 2v2SE 10th Anniversary и Bryston BDA-3 DA; АЦП RME ADI-2 Pro с внешним источником питания; предусилители Pass Labs XP-22 и Wyred 4 Sound STP-SE Stage 2; усилители мощности Wyred 4 Sound ST-750 LE, Valve E2 и Pass Labs XA30.

8; Громкоговорители Focal Sopra 1 с самыми низкими частотами в несколько герц, поставляемые парой сабвуферов JL Audio e110, и громкоговорители Focal Chorus 714, позаимствованные у системы HT. Аудиокабели — это Audioquest WEL Signature, межблочные кабели Mogami и акустические кабели. USB-кабели имеют прямой провод USB-F. Шнуры питания включают в себя мой шнур питания DIY и Straight Wire Pro Thunder. Защиту и очистку питания обеспечивает PS Audio Dectet для предусилителей и компонентов-источников, а также PS Audio Quintet для усилителей мощности. Quintet обеспечивает дистанционное включение и выключение усилителей мощности, в которых отсутствует дистанционный триггер 12 В.

После первоначального 300-часового периода обкатки быстро становится очевидным удивительно богатое и человечески звучащее среднечастотное звучание. Существует очень хорошее разрешение по октавам с пониманием того, что окончательное звучание предусилителя было принято дизайнерами и инженерами, которые высоко ценят превосходный ламповый звук. Что это значит? Ответ на этот вопрос является основным выводом этого обзора.

Твердотельные компоненты обычно отличаются мощным контролируемым басом и расширением до самых высоких частот. Ламповый механизм особенно ценится за богатую гармоническую плотность в средних и нижних частотах. VK-43SE очень хорошо сочетает в себе эти два качества. Вокальный диапазон имеет очень сильное сходство с ламповым качеством, а бас — очень мощный «твердотельный» звук.

Басовый диапазон очень высокого качества с очень желанным плотным, быстрым высоким разрешением, которое часто обеспечивает тот самый «удар под дых», сотрясает фундамент, хлопает и мощнее, с выдающимся разрешением. Басовые ноты обладают превосходной глубиной и ясно передают вибрацию отдельных струн. Общий характер баса не тот сухой и безжизненный, который преобладал в старых твердотельных колонках. Подумайте о лучшем ламповом басе, который вы когда-либо слышали, а затем добавьте скорость деформации и громоподобную динамическую мощность на низких частотах, и вы поймете качество баса этого предусилителя BAT.

Средние частоты особенные. И мужской, и женский вокал представлены с теплотой и богатством, придающим тело и глубину всем певцам. Инструменты имеют удивительно полные основные тона с естественным гармоническим аккомпанементом в нижних дискантах. В самой ламповой СЧ-диапазоне нет хэша, зернистости, зернистости и других надоедливых искажений. Это действительно замечательный предусилитель, впечатляющий при прослушивании музыки с певцами от одного до ста голосов. Все они представлены с ясностью, что делает простой задачей «увидеть» отдельных исполнителей на большой трехмерной сцене.

Вокал Марка Нопфлера в песне «Ромео и Джульетта» из альбома Dire Straits Making Movies невероятно яркий и текстурный. Бонни Райт, особенно на ее LP Luck of the Draw, также звучит удивительно живо и живо. Эти два примера не уникальны. Весь вокал представлен красиво.

Верхний диск очень ламповый и похож на Mullard 12AU7, который теплее и более сфокусирован на средних частотах, чем, например, лампа Telefunken. Расширение верхних высоких частот немного отложено. Все детали и разрешение, которые есть на записи, присутствуют у VK-43SE, только относительно утоплены по сравнению с нижними высокими частотами. Многие слушатели сочтут этот баланс идеальным, подобно тому, как некоторые слушатели находят звук полупроводниковых предусилителей ярким и направленным. Все дело в системной синергии, с  вы являетесь частью системы.

Звуковая сцена может быть огромной, с большим пространством и атмосферой, как того требует запись. Это одна из многих сильных сторон предусилителя. Центральное изображение твердое, трехмерное и сфокусированное. Инструменты поставляются с превосходным размещением на четко определенной звуковой сцене, с превосходной глубиной и высотой. Каждый исполнитель расположен четко, с отличным отделением от соседних музыкантов, хотя и с не совсем резкими очертаниями, обеспечиваемыми предусилителем Pass Labs XP-22. Особенно примечательно восприятие глубины в самых дальних уголках сцены спектакля. Многие компоненты не могут так глубоко проникнуть в звуковую сцену.

Наиболее важное различие между предусилителями VK-43SE, Pass Labs XP-22 (9000 долл. США) и Wyred 4 Sound STP-SE Stage 2 (3749 долл. США) заключается в представлении средних и верхних частот, а именно в линейности (расширении) , по сравнению с обходом. Обход предусилителя просто включает в себя подключение штекерного разъема XLR кабеля источника напрямую к гнездовому разъему XLR кабеля усилителя и управление громкостью в ЦАП или программном обеспечении — с большой осторожностью и планированием регулировки громкости. (Извините, винил. Для этого теста вы находитесь на стенде.) По порядку того, как звук каждого предусилителя на верхних частотах сравнивается со звуком прямой конфигурации с шунтом, предусилитель Wyred 4 Sound является «мертвым орехом». там, за ним XP-22, а VK-43SE занимает заднюю позицию. Это озвучивание. Качество есть у всех трех предусилителей, отличается только подача. При более прямом сравнении VK-43SE имеет большую чистоту и свободу от электронной подписи, чем XP-22.

По моему опыту, предусилитель в целом звучит лучше, чем отдельные лампы. Это не ранний Sovtek 6922 с жестким и агрессивным типом звука. Наоборот, владелец будет вознагражден ламповым общим характером, который может стать конечным результатом после всех замен ламп, которые мы часто делаем на компонент с вакуумными лампами. Однако здесь вы откажетесь от этих усилий и затрат при первоначальном выборе, а затем снова, когда потребуется замена трубок. В этом предварительном усилителе нет никаких ламп, но вы получаете такой уровень качества звука.

Стань бескамерным! BAT VK-43SE может доставить вас туда. Благодаря мощным басам и четким верхам этот предусилитель определенно более линейный и точный, чем многие полностью ламповые предусилители. Вы получаете богатство и контроль, которые могут заставить вас переоценить потребность в лампах. Для часто предпочтительной комбинации лампового предусилителя с полупроводниковым усилителем мощности предусилитель VK-43SE отлично подойдет и настоятельно рекомендуется.

Добавить комментарий

Ваш адрес email не будет опубликован. Обязательные поля помечены *

Закрыть
Menu